Material Composition and Durability
The material composition of a Guide Gearcase is a critical factor that directly influences its durability and performance. High-quality Guide Gearcases are typically crafted from robust materials such as heat-treated steel or advanced alloys. These materials offer superior strength and resistance to wear, ensuring longevity even under demanding conditions. When evaluating material composition, pay close attention to factors such as tensile strength, impact resistance, and thermal stability. A Guide Gearcase manufactured from premium materials will better withstand the rigors of daily use, including exposure to extreme temperatures, vibrations, and mechanical stress. Additionally, consider the surface treatment of the gearcase, such as case hardening or nitriding, which can significantly enhance its durability and corrosion resistance. Opting for a Guide Gearcase with superior material properties may involve a higher initial investment, but it often translates to reduced maintenance costs and extended service life, making it a wise choice for discerning vehicle owners.

Gear Ratio and Efficiency
The gear ratio of a Guide Gearcase plays a pivotal role in determining your vehicle's performance characteristics, including acceleration, top speed, and fuel efficiency. A properly selected gear ratio can optimize power delivery, enhancing overall driving dynamics. When considering gear ratios, it's essential to balance factors such as engine power, vehicle weight, and intended use. Lower gear ratios provide increased torque multiplication, beneficial for off-road vehicles or those requiring strong low-end performance. Conversely, higher gear ratios are more suitable for highway cruising and fuel economy. The efficiency of the Guide Gearcase is equally important, as it affects power transmission and fuel consumption. Look for gearcases designed with precision-engineered gears and advanced lubricants to minimize friction and heat generation. High-efficiency Guide Gearcases not only improve performance but also contribute to reduced wear and extended component life. Consider consulting with drivetrain specialists to determine the optimal gear ratio and efficiency specifications for your specific vehicle and driving needs, ensuring a perfect balance between performance and practicality.

Cooling and Lubrication Systems
The cooling and lubrication systems of a Guide Gearcase are critical for maintaining optimal performance and longevity. When evaluating different models, pay close attention to their cooling and lubrication capabilities, especially if your vehicle is used in high-performance applications or challenging environments. Advanced Guide Gearcases may feature integrated cooling systems, such as oil pumps or external coolers, which help dissipate heat more effectively. This is particularly important for vehicles subjected to heavy loads, frequent towing, or high-speed operation. Consider the type and quality of lubricants recommended for the Guide Gearcase, as using the correct lubricant is essential for proper function and wear prevention. Some high-performance Guide Gearcases may require synthetic lubricants or special additives to maintain peak efficiency. Evaluate the ease of maintenance and accessibility of fill and drain ports, as regular fluid changes are crucial for long-term reliability. Additionally, consider the gearcase's sealing system, which prevents lubricant leakage and protects against contaminant ingress. A well-designed cooling and lubrication system not only enhances performance but also significantly extends the service life of your Guide Gearcase, reducing the need for costly repairs or replacements.

Performance Characteristics
The performance of a guide gearcase can significantly impact your driving experience. Key performance characteristics to consider include steering ratio, torque capacity, and responsiveness. The steering ratio determines how much the wheels turn in relation to the steering wheel's movement. A higher ratio typically results in lighter steering effort but may require more turns of the wheel for a given amount of wheel movement.
Torque capacity is another crucial factor, especially for larger vehicles or those used in demanding applications. Ensure the gearcase you choose can handle the expected loads and forces it will encounter during operation. Additionally, consider the overall responsiveness of the gearcase. A well-designed unit should provide precise and immediate feedback, allowing for accurate control and enhanced driving confidence.
